1973 VW Beetle Electrical Connection Guide
Connect the main positive lead from the battery to the fuse block using a 15-amp inline fuse. Verify that the connection is tight and free of corrosion to maintain stable voltage across the system.
Attach the chassis ground securely to a clean metal surface on the floor pan or engine compartment. This prevents voltage drops and ensures reliable operation of all circuits.
Use the following steps to route accessory circuits:
- Identify each line by color code: red for power, black for ground, green for turn signals, brown for taillights, and blue for auxiliary circuits.
- Check continuity of each wire using a multimeter before final attachment.
- Secure wires with zip ties to avoid contact with moving parts or heat sources.
Instrument panel connections should match factory pin assignments. Align each terminal carefully to prevent misreads on gauges and malfunction of indicator lights.
Lighting circuits such as headlights, brake lights, and turn signals must be routed separately from high-current lines to reduce interference. Confirm bulb operation before reinstalling lens covers.
For ignition and starter circuits, use the original harness wherever possible. Ensure each lead reaches its respective terminal without stretching to avoid insulation damage.
Test all circuits systematically. Turn on each system individually, monitor for correct voltage at the terminals, and check for any signs of overheating or poor connections.
Label each connection clearly if additional modifications are planned. This practice simplifies future maintenance and ensures correct reconnection of all electrical components.
